One radian is the angle subtended by an arc whose length equals the radius. A full turn is 2π radians, so radians connect angle directly to circle geometry.
Convert degrees using θ(rad)=θ°π/180. In radian measure, arc length is s=rθ and sector area is ½r²θ, with θ in radians.
For r=5 and θ=1.2, the arc length is 6 units and the sector area is 15 square units. Using 1.2° instead would give a completely different scale.
Do not substitute degrees into s=rθ or ½r²θ. Check the angle unit before using a formula.
